/**
* @author: Thomas Steiner (tomac@google.com)
* @license CC0 1.0 Universal (CC0 1.0)
*/
/* jshint shadow:true, loopfunc:true, -W034, -W097 */
/* global MccApp, AdWordsApp, SpreadsheetApp, Logger */
'use strict';
// Store the output here
var SPREADSHEET_URL = '';
// AWQL query
var SELECT_VALUES = [
'ExternalCustomerId',
'AccountDescriptiveName',
'Clicks',
'Impressions'
];
var REPORT_QUERY = 'SELECT ' + SELECT_VALUES.join(', ') + ' ' +
'FROM ACCOUNT_PERFORMANCE_REPORT ' +
'WHERE Clicks > 0 ' +
'DURING LAST_30_DAYS';
var PURGE_AFTER = 30 /* days */ * (24 * 60 * 60 * 1000) /* in milliseconds */;
// 20141217
var now = (new Date()).toISOString().substr(0, 10).replace(/-/g, '').toString();
function main() {
// Remove remoteStorage items that were not from today
for (var i = 0, lenI = remoteStorage.getLength(); i < lenI; i++) {
var key = remoteStorage.key(i);
if (key !== now) {
remoteStorage.removeItem(key);
}
}
// Start processing
var processedAccounts = remoteStorage.getItem(now) || {};
var notProcessedAccounts = {};
var parallelExecutionLimit = 50;
var accountIterator = MccApp.accounts().get();
while (accountIterator.hasNext()) {
var account = accountIterator.next();
var cid = account.getCustomerId();
if (!processedAccounts[cid]) {
notProcessedAccounts[cid] = false;
Logger.log('Not yet processed account ' + cid);
} else {
Logger.log('Already processed account ' + cid);
}
}
// Process in chunks according to the parallel execution limit
var i = 0;
var currentRun = [];
for (var cid in notProcessedAccounts) {
if (i < parallelExecutionLimit) {
currentRun.push(cid);
} else {
Logger.log('Maximum executeInParallel limit reached, starting parallel ' +
'processing');
break;
}
i++;
}
var accountSelector = MccApp.accounts().withIds(currentRun);
accountSelector.executeInParallel('getReport', 'storeReports');
}
/**
* Gets an AWQL report
*/
function getReport() {
var account = AdWordsApp.currentAccount();
var report = AdWordsApp.report(REPORT_QUERY);
var rows = report.rows();
var result = [];
var i = 0;
while (rows.hasNext()) {
var row = rows.next();
var line = [];
SELECT_VALUES.forEach(function(selectValue, j) {
if (selectValue === 'Date') {
// Prevent Spreadsheets date parsing magic
line[j] = row[selectValue].replace(/-/g, '');
} else {
line[j] = row[selectValue];
}
});
line.push(now);
result[i] = line;
i++;
}
if (!result.length) {
return;
}
return JSON.stringify(result);
}
/**
* Stores reports in a spreadsheet
*/
function storeReports(results) {
var spreadsheet = SpreadsheetApp.openByUrl(SPREADSHEET_URL);
var sheet = spreadsheet.getSheetByName('Report') !== null ?
spreadsheet.getSheetByName('Report') : spreadsheet.insertSheet('Report');
// Create the header if necessary
SELECT_VALUES.push('Timestamp');
var headerLength = SELECT_VALUES.length;
if (sheet.getLastRow() < 2) {
sheet.getRange(1, 1, 1, headerLength).setValues([SELECT_VALUES]);
sheet.setFrozenRows(1);
}
var timestampIndex = SELECT_VALUES.indexOf('Timestamp') || false;
// Delete values that are older than PURGE_AFTER days
var nowMilliseconds = Date.now();
var values = sheet.getRange(1, 1, sheet.getLastRow(), sheet.getLastColumn())
.getValues();
var bulkDeletionRows = [];
var bulkDeletionCounter = -1;
var last = -2;
for (var i = 0, lenI = values.length; i < lenI; i++) {
if (!timestampIndex) {
break;
}
if (values[i] && values[i][timestampIndex]) {
// Ugly date parsing here, as we prevent Spreadsheets date parsing magic
var date = values[i][timestampIndex].toString();
var dateMilliseconds = Date.parse(
date.substring(0, 4) + '/' +
date.substring(4, 6) + '/' +
date.substring(6, 8));
if (nowMilliseconds - dateMilliseconds > PURGE_AFTER) {
// If the rows are non-sequential, we need a new bulk deletion bucket
if (i - last > 1) {
bulkDeletionCounter++;
bulkDeletionRows[bulkDeletionCounter] = [];
}
bulkDeletionRows[bulkDeletionCounter].push(i + 2);
last = i;
}
}
}
// Reverse, so that we delete from the bottom up so that indices remain valid
bulkDeletionRows.reverse();
bulkDeletionRows.forEach(function(bulkDeletionBucket) {
var bucketLength = bulkDeletionBucket.length;
Logger.log('Deleting old rows from ' + bulkDeletionBucket[0] + '–' +
bulkDeletionBucket[bucketLength - 1]);
sheet.deleteRows(bulkDeletionBucket[0], bucketLength);
});
// Write new values
var rows = [];
var processedItems = remoteStorage.getItem(now) || {};
for (var i = 0, lenI = results.length; i < lenI; i++) {
var result = results[i];
var cid = result.getCustomerId();
processedItems[cid] = true;
if (result.getError() !== null || result.getStatus() !== 'OK') {
Logger.log(result.getError() || 'Error for ' + result.getCustomerId());
continue;
}
if (result.getReturnValue() === 'undefined') {
Logger.log('No results for ' + result.getCustomerId());
continue;
}
Logger.log('Storing results for ' + result.getCustomerId());
var lines = JSON.parse(result.getReturnValue());
lines.forEach(function(line) {
rows.push(line);
});
}
if (rows.length) {
sheet.getRange(sheet.getLastRow() + 1, 1, rows.length, rows[0].length)
.setValues(rows);
}
remoteStorage.setItem(now, processedItems);
Logger.log('Done :-D');
}
/**
* @author Thomas Steiner (tomac@google.com)
* @license CC0 1.0 Universal (CC0 1.0)
*
* Provides a simple key-value storage API modeled closely after
* the localStorage API in Web browsers, but tailored to AdWords Scripts.
* AdWords Scripts, due to execution time limits published at
* https://developers.google.com/adwords/scripts/docs/limits,
* forces users to store the state of a given script using either labels
* (https://developers.google.com/adwords/scripts/docs/tips#labels), or
* some other mechanism. This script provides such mechanism.
*
* Usage:
*
* 1) Create a Spreadsheet and pass its URL to the constant SPREADSHEET_URL.
*
* 2) Copy and paste the script into your AdWords script. This exposes
* a remoteStorage object with the following API:
*
* - remoteStorage.setItem('myKey', {value: 'my_value'});
* - remoteStorage.getItem('myKey'); // returns {value: 'my_value'}
* - remoteStorage.removeItem('myKey'); // removes the item with key 'myKey'
* - remoteStorage.getLength(); // returns 0
* - remoteStorage.clear();
*
* Note: unlike with localStorage, you do not need to JSON.parse/stringify
* the values, the script takes care of this.
*/
var remoteStorage = (function() {
'use strict';
var spreadsheet = SpreadsheetApp.openByUrl(SPREADSHEET_URL);
var sheet = spreadsheet.getSheetByName('_remoteStorage') !== null ?
spreadsheet.getSheetByName('_remoteStorage') :
spreadsheet.insertSheet('_remoteStorage');
var length = sheet.getDataRange().getValues().length;
return {
getItem: function(key) {
if (!key) {
return;
}
key = key.toString();
var values = sheet.getDataRange().getValues();
for (var i = 0, lenI = values.length; i < lenI; i++) {
var currentKey = values[i][0].toString();
if (currentKey === key && values[i][1]) {
return JSON.parse(values[i][1]);
}
}
return null;
},
setItem: function(key, value) {
if (!key || !value) {
return;
}
key = key.toString();
value = JSON.stringify(value);
var values = sheet.getDataRange().getValues();
for (var i = 0, lenI = values.length; i < lenI; i++) {
var currentKey = values[i][0].toString();
if (currentKey === key) {
var range = sheet.getRange(i + 1, 1, 1, 2);
length++;
return range.setValues([[key, value]]);
}
}
length++;
return sheet.appendRow([key, value]);
},
removeItem: function(key) {
if (!key) {
return;
}
key = key.toString();
var values = sheet.getDataRange().getValues();
for (var i = 0, lenI = values.length; i < lenI; i++) {
var currentKey = values[i][0].toString();
if (currentKey === key) {
length--;
return sheet.deleteRow(i + 1);
}
}
},
key: function(index) {
var values = sheet.getDataRange().getValues();
if (values[index][0]) {
return values[index][0].toString();
}
return null;
},
clear: function() {
sheet.clear();
length = 0;
},
getLength: function() {
return length;
}
};
})();
